Why Millennials Are Seeking New Church Experiences

Millennials, typically defined as those born between 1981 and 1996, are known for their diverse perspectives and strong values. Many are leaving traditional church settings in search of communities that reflect their ideals. Here are a few reasons why millennials are evolving in their spiritual journeys:

  • Inclusivity: Millennials desire acceptance and inclusivity, often seeking out churches that embrace diversity in their theology, practices, and congregation.
  • Authenticity: There is a strong desire for authenticity in relationships and teachings. Millennials prefer congregations that foster genuine connection and transparency.
  • Social Justice: Many young adults are motivated by social justice issues, looking for churches that actively engage in their communities and align with their values.
  • Modern Worship Styles: Many prefer more contemporary worship experiences that incorporate music, art, and technology, making their spiritual encounters lively and engaging.

2. Hillsong Church

Hillsong Church has gained immense popularity globally, especially among millennials. Their services are characterized by:

  • World-Class Worship Music: Hillsong’s music has influenced contemporary Christian music worldwide, appealing strongly to a younger audience.
  • Global Community: With campuses around the world, Hillsong maintains a sense of global community while focusing on local outreach.
  • Relevant Teaching: They often address contemporary social issues in their sermons, speaking directly to the concerns of millennials.

3. Elevation Church

Elevation Church, led by Steven Furtick, is known for its innovative approach, including:

  • Creative Worship Services: Utilizing modern technology and engaging visuals, their services provide an immersive experience.
  • Focus on Personal Growth: Elevation emphasizes personal and spiritual growth through well-structured teaching and community support.
  • Online Accessibility: With a robust online presence, their services reach thousands who prefer virtual participation.

4. Mosaic Church

Mosaic Church, based in Los Angeles, offers a vibrant community rich with culture. Key features include:

  • Artistic Expression: The church embraces arts and culture, incorporating creative forms of worship that resonate with millennial values.
  • Community Focus: Mosaic’s outreach initiatives are designed to serve the community and address pressing social issues.
  • Small Group Opportunities: The church fosters small group experiences that allow for deep connections and support among members.

5. Life.Church

Life.Church is known for its appeal to younger generations through:

  • Innovative Use of Technology: Known for their strong online presence, Life.Church offers an extensive library of resources, including an app for easy access to sermons and resources.
  • Engaging Sermons: Sermons are relevant and relatable, often addressing everyday issues faced by millennials.
  • Community Events: The church hosts numerous events that bring community members together for fun and fellowship.

Navigating Your Church Search

Finding a church that meets your needs can be a rewarding journey. Here are some tips to help you navigate this process:

1. Define Your Values

Before embarking on your search, take time to reflect on your own values and what you're looking for in a faith community. Are you seeking a church that emphasizes social justice? Or one that focuses on traditional teachings? Knowing your priorities will guide your search.

2. Visit Multiple Churches

Don't hesitate to visit several churches. Each community has its own unique culture, and experiencing a few can help you feel out where you fit best. Pay attention to the worship style, community interaction, and overall vibe.

3. Engage with the Community

Once you find a couple of churches that resonate with you, immerse yourself by participating in small groups or volunteer opportunities. This engagement will allow you to forge connections and better understand the church's mission.

4. Utilize Online Resources

Many churches host podcasts, live streams, and blogs to share their teachings and events. Exploring these resources can provide insight into the church's values and connect you with their community before visiting in person.
